Introduction
The Grenoble MSc Innovation, Strategy & Entrepreneurship is designed for students who want to be successful entrepreneurs or innovative managers. The program covers key concepts of general management, plus modules focused on entrepreneurial skills.
The MSc ISE allows students to participate in a live business case with a real company, an international study residency, and a variety of workshops.
This program is studied over two years, one academic year (on campus) + Final Management Project (FMP) (12 months parallel with an internship or full-time employment). Free beginner's German classes for all students. Flexible payment plans are available!

Curriculum
Modules
Year I
Introduction session - general management and the corporate environment
- Accounting
- Corporate Finance
- Insight into Digital
- Intercultural Management
- International Negotiations
- Leadership, Teambuilding, and Managerial Creativity
- Legal Environment of International Business
- Managerial Economics
- Project Management
- Research Methods for Managers
- Personal Branding for Career Success
- Digital Analytics
Innovation Management
- Introduction to Innovation
- Creativity and Innovation
- Innovation & Design Thinking
- Marketing High Tech and Innovation
Strategy
- Strategic Management
- Harvard Course: Microeconomics of Competitiveness
- Mergers, Acquisitions, and Restructuring
- Strategic Marketing and Marketing Planning
Entrepreneurship
- Introduction to Entrepreneurship
- New Venture Business Planning
- Entrepreneurship and Business Opportunities
- Small and Family Business
Year II
Final Management Project
- The second year of the program is dedicated to the Final Management Project, conducted under the supervision of a tutor. This is an applied or theoretical research project that can be completed at a distance and in parallel with full-time employment or an approved internship. Students are encouraged to choose a subject related to their preferred career.
